Agusan Sur cops achieve another success in anti-drug operation


PROSPERIDAD, Agusan del Sur -- The personnel from Esperanza Municipal Police Station (MPS) and Philippine Drug Enforcement Agency (PDEA) - Agusan del Sur conducted a buy-bust operation on February 17, 2024 (Saturday) at about 3:15 AM at P-1, Barangay Crossing Luna, Esperanza, Agusan del Sur, which resulted in the apprehension of a suspect and the seizure of illicit substances.

The said operation had led to the confiscation of the following items:

a. Four pieces of transparent heat-sealed plastic sachets containing white crystalline substance suspected to be shabu with a total value of P8,160;

b. One piece  of orange lighter; 

c. One piece five hundred-peso (P500) bill as buy-bust money with serial no.MH349159; and 

d. Two pieces of aluminum foil. 

Police Colonel Jovito Canlapan, provincial director of Agusan Del Sur Police Provincial Office (ADSPPO) said that the arrested suspects and confiscated items are now under the custody of Esperanza MPS for proper disposition. 

The law enforcement agency is committed to ensuring that all necessary procedures and legal steps are followed to maintain the integrity of the case.

"I am sending a clear message that drug-related activities will not be tolerated in our province, and we will continue to stand firm in our pursuit of justice," Canlapan said.
